Transaction 685ea02270bc7a028875f821307cc589f5b5f2b174afb9868ab97973fdbae4e1
1 Input
1 Output
-
685ea02270bc7a028875f821307cc589f5b5f2b174afb9868ab97973fdbae4e1:0
- value
- 3327356
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c849f52d7eba81e0139f7ae9383de52f997667fe OP_EQUAL
- address
- 3Kx3fakRG1oKv7BARECdUh78NKoSNhWMCQ